The PDF file was flagged by ML classifiers and ClamAV as malicious, specifically detecting a PDF exploit. A JavaScript action was found within the PDF, indicating an attempt to execute malicious code. The embedded JavaScript is likely responsible for exploiting a vulnerability to achieve code execution.
